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,944,603
Lastest Block:
1,964,513
Utxos:
1,983,837
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
23/07/2025 01:08:32 UTC
Txid
29003247aa535ddc953608c6cf11ec5ec8845d85b1b06a7137003a66e5285c54
Block
1,803,137
Block hash
2b9978dbdbf9d2327b5a50973c504dbfb2d2353a52192920b52022fc1be43828
Stake amount
181.1172679 XEP
Sender
ep1q8wggx9kfwfjpxp26psud86yje00ym206pkhkhm
Recipient
ep1q4k0wp92d983ur863g70eda4u5u6k9q8j9ju4sz
(2,104,318.44835438 XEP)